An article titled “Improving Relationships” by Kyle W. Morrison in Safety + Health magazine examines the relationship between OSHA Region 9 and federal OSHA, as well as other states.  OSHA Region 9 is made up of Hawaii, California, Nevada and Arizona; these states operate their own occupational safety programs.  However, following a series of workplace deaths in Nevada, OSHA reported serious problems with the state’s program.  A federal review of all state plans was then performed.  The results were concerning and prompted working together with other states and federal OSHA to improve workplace safety.

The most cited OSHA standards in Region 9 for 2010 were:

  1. 1910.1200 Hazard Communication
  2. 1910.404 Wiring Design and Protection
  3. 1926.405 Wiring Methods, Components and Equipment for General Use
  4. 1910.178 Powered Industrial Trucks
  5. 1926.95 Criteria for Personal Protective Equipment
  6. 1910.157 Portable Fire Extinguishers
  7. 1910.37 Maintenance, Safeguards and Operational Features for Exit Routes
  8. 1910.303 Electrical-General Requirements
  9. 1910.305 Wiring Methods, Components and Equipment for general Use
  10. 1926.1053 Ladders
